Digital Marketing Specialist - 12 months FTC
Hays Milton Keynes, England, United Kingdom
Role Overview
This role offers a salary range of £35,000 - £40,000 per annum, or £19 - £25 per hour, based on skills and experience. The position is full-time, with 35 hours per week, Monday to Friday, 09:00 - 17:00, located in Milton Keynes with a hybrid work arrangement (3 days in Tongwell, 2 days remote).
Key Responsibilities
1. Support the Digital Brand Marketing Manager in developing, delivering, and optimizing national media campaigns to meet sales objectives, focusing on product launches and luxury vehicle segments.
2. Collaborate with creative teams, media agencies, and external partners to execute campaigns across digital, social, outdoor, experiential, and broadcast platforms.
3. Enhance media impact through strategic planning and explore new media opportunities to reach prospects and existing customers.
4. Contribute to creative and media process development, working closely with agencies.
5. Coordinate with internal teams (product, sales, PR) to align marketing strategies with business goals.
6. Leverage analytics for insights, execution, and optimization of digital campaigns to generate leads.
7. Maintain brand consistency and campaign efficiency by collaborating with the Region Europe Content Hub Team.
8. Monitor, analyze, and report on campaign performance using data-driven insights.
9. Manage budgets and financial administration, including purchase orders, invoices, and accruals.
